What Are Multiplayer Fishing Games?
Multiplayer fishing games are digital simulations that allow players to engage in fishing activities
with one another in a virtual environment. These games can range from highly realistic simulations to more
casual, arcade-style experiences. The key component that binds them is the emphasis on multiplayer interaction,
which allows players to either compete against one another or collaborate in specific fishing challenges.
The social aspect enhances the gaming experience, creating a vibrant community of fishing enthusiasts.
Types of Multiplayer Fishing Games
Multiplayer fishing games can be broadly categorized into various types based on gameplay mechanics and
experiences offered. Here are some common types you might encounter:
1. Competitive Fishing Games
In these games, players compete against each other to catch the biggest or the most fish within a certain
timeframe. A leader board often tracks scores, and players can showcase their skills in tournaments or
daily challenges. Examples include games like “Fishing Planet” and “Ultimate Fishing Simulator.”
2. Cooperative Fishing Games
Some games focus on teamwork, allowing players to work together to achieve common goals. These can include
catching specific fish species or completing missions collectively. Titles like “Fishing Adventures” often
incorporate this cooperative element, enhancing the social experience of fishing.
3. Casual Fishing Games

Casual fishing games are generally more accessible with simple controls and mechanics. They cater to
a broader audience and often include colorful graphics, fun sound effects, and less realistic fishing
experiences. Games like “Fishdom” and “Fish with Attitude” are examples of this genre that often blend
puzzles and fishing elements.
